Main Activity Of National Cooperative Soil Survey
-: NCSS partners work to cooperatively investigate, inventory, document, classify, and interpret soils and to disseminate, publish, and promote the use of information about the soils of the United States and its trust territories.
-: The activities of the NCSS are carried out on national, regional, and State levels.
-: NCSS creates standards that provide common or shared procedures to enhance technology transfer, data sharing, and communications among soil survey participants.
-: NCSS organizes conferences and publishes a newsletter.
